Why Is React Not Working?

You know what I'm talking about, right? React. You guys really did take the web development industry by storm with your JavaScript package. With its virtual wand and spell-casting abilities on those websites, it resembles the belle of the ball. But, you guys, what's wrong with React? Allow me to explain it to you.
First of all, Facebook's clever people created the frontend library React. It all comes down to designing dynamic, engaging user interfaces. React combines JavaScript and HTML using a unique vocabulary called JSX, which makes managing components and state changes simpler.
React's virtual DOM is a major factor in its popularity. Now, don't misunderstand; there isn't a true DOM, folks. React uses it as a kind of secret twin to monitor changes made to the DOM and only updates the necessary parts. React is now really quick and effective, everyone.
The component-based architecture of React is another feature that distinguishes it from other libraries. You can disassemble the user interface (UI) into modular pieces, much like Legos, and assemble them into a powerful fortress. As a result, working with the team and managing the codebase are made simpler.
But there's still more! React Developer Tools are a useful tool that is included with React. It functions similarly to a magnifying glass for code, assisting you in real-time debugging and component inspection. It's as powerful as a superpower for developers, you guys.
You may be asking yourself, "What's up with all those hooks in React?" at this point. Let me tell you, though. React now has a feature called hooks that lets you use state and other capabilities without having to develop class components for them. For the developers, it's like a breath of fresh air, as it makes managing the states and side effects easier.
Don't believe me, though; major corporations like Netflix, Airbnb, and Instagram employ React. They rely on React to build slick, intuitive user interfaces that entice users to return time and time again. It's comparable to their exclusive blend in the web building formula, folks.
What is the conclusion regarding React? You better think it's here to stay, then. React is a developer’s toolkit equivalent of a reliable steed because of its speed, efficiency, and versatility. It makes it easy to construct amazing websites and applications, almost like a golden ticket to the realm of current web development.
To sum up, React is the genuine deal, everyone. It resembles a western hero riding into town and taking control of the web development industry. React is a powerful tool with a virtual DOM, component-based architecture, and clever hooks. Thus, keep in mind that React is like a breath of fresh air in the realm of frontend development the next time someone asks, "What's up with React?"